## Limits & Quotas: Shelfhawk Catalog Cache

Shelfhawk invalidates catalog entries per-SKU; bulk purges are throttled to protect origin databases. Support agents can trigger manual invalidation, but requests beyond the hourly quota are queued, not rejected, so customers may see stale prices for up to fifteen minutes during spikes. Escalate only if staleness exceeds the queue SLA. The enforced values are:

tuning table, yajog-yahof:
BUDGETS = {
    "lamvan": 303,
    "wenox": 460,
    "fenvan": 525,
}

## Deployment

The Quillbrook service ships with two official client SDKs: one for the Lark runtime and one for the Pebbleworks runtime. As of this release the two are at full feature parity, including streaming uploads, retry policies, and schema negotiation. Plugin authors should not assume parity in older tags—verify the SDK version before targeting a deployment. Both SDKs read the same server-side settings, so a single deployment serves either client. The deployed service resolves those settings from the values shown below.

settings of fafog-haduf:
ZORIX_PIN=4648
ZORIX_METRICS_HOST=metrics.zorix.paliqsys.corp
ZORIX_LOG_LEVEL=info
ZORIX_TENANT=druix

**☐ Data-centre cage visit (Hollowmere Site B)**

Confirm your escort from the Brindle Systems facilities team has signed you in at the perimeter office before proceeding. Wear your contractor lanyard visibly at all times, leave all photographic equipment in the lockers provided, and follow the marked walkway to Cage Row 4. Do not touch any racks outside your assigned cage. At the inner mantrap, your escort will ask you to enter the door-pass code printed below.

turnstile pass: bdg-NG-3

Connection pooling in the Drossel ledger service is handled by our in-house PoolMarsh layer. Pools are sized per replica, not per node, so resist the urge to scale them with CPU count. Idle reaping runs every sweep interval described in section 4. The constants governing all of this are defined below.

tuning constants:
BUDGETS = {
    "druath": 240,
    "lamwyn": 180,
    "silael": 275,
}